I Am Not

I am Not I am not a gambling man nor one who begs for coins, Nor one of a joyous revelry who shall drink the wine of kings, Nor one who stands with withered brow on a cold, December night And yearns for dawn and summertime to softly steal in; And I shall not wait for judgment day, my eyes to the wind of fate Nor one who’s content with the worth of his land, and the toil of his muscled bones, Nor he who listens to sounds of the gull in this harsh and frigid land, And sees the sign of passing time in the solitude he recalls And I am not a man of thought, who ponders the stars up in the sky, Nor one of silent imagery, who dreams of days gone by, Nor he who works with blackened hands as the sun begins to fade, And brushes back his withered brow,to hear the words that lovers call; I am just a man of trust, who did accept the worth of time and place, And the wealth unknown as I stand alone and wonder of my passing life; A man of hope and a man of dream, and a man of less emotion, Who wakes each morning to a brighter day then the one that past before By Mark Norton
